Salesforce is a powerful platform that helps businesses manage customer relationships, sales processes, and marketing activities. But like any software platform, it is not immune to bugs and errors. A robust and comprehensive testing process ensures that Salesforce functions as intended. This article will explore the importance of the Salesforce testing life cycle and how it can help businesses avoid costly errors, improve user experience, and ultimately drive growth and success. Consider enhancing your skills with Salesforce Testing Training in Chennai at FITA Academy to master the testing process and contribute to the success of Salesforce implementations.

Introduction to Salesforce Testing Life Cycle

Salesforce testing life cycle is a structured approach to testing Salesforce applications, which includes planning, designing, executing, and reporting on tests. The testing life cycle aims to ensure that Salesforce applications are working as intended, meeting business requirements, and delivering value to users. The testing life cycle typically includes the following phases:

  1. Test Planning: This phase involves defining the testing objectives, identifying test cases, and determining the testing scope and timelines.
  2. Test Design: Test cases are designed in this phase, and test data is prepared. Test cases should cover all possible scenarios and use cases, including positive and negative testing.
  3. Test Execution: This phase involves executing the test cases and tracking defects. Test results are recorded, and defects are reported to the development team for resolution.
  4. Test Reporting: Test results and metrics are analyzed in this phase, and a summary report is created. The summary report details the testing process, test coverage, and defects found.

Importance of Salesforce Testing Life Cycle

The Salesforce testing life cycle is critical to ensuring that Salesforce applications work as intended and meet business requirements. Here are some reasons why testing is important:

  1. Quality Assurance: Testing is essential to ensuring that Salesforce applications meet quality standards and are error-free. B bugs and errors can go undetected without testing, leading to poor user experience and lost revenue.
  2. User Experience: Testing ensures that Salesforce applications are user-friendly and intuitive. A good user experience is essential to user adoption and engagement, which can drive growth and success.
  3. Cost Savings: Testing can help businesses avoid costly errors and rework. By identifying defects early in the development cycle, businesses can save time and resources.
  4. Compliance: Testing ensures that Salesforce applications comply with regulatory requirements and industry standards.

Best Practices for Salesforce Testing Life Cycle

To ensure that the testing life cycle is effective and efficient, businesses should follow best practices. Here are some best practices for Salesforce testing:

  1. Define Testing Objectives: Before beginning testing, defining the testing objectives and determining the scope and timelines is essential.
  2. Use Test Automation: Test automation can help businesses save time and resources by automating repetitive testing tasks. This can also help improve test coverage and reduce the risk of human error.
  3. Test Early and Often: Testing should begin early in the development cycle and continue throughout the software development life cycle. This can help identify defects early and reduce the risk of costly errors.
  4. Use Realistic Test Data: Test data should be realistic and representative of actual user data. This can help ensure that testing accurately reflects real-world scenarios.
  5. Monitor Test Results: Test results should be monitored closely to identify trends and patterns. This can help identify areas for improvement and optimize the testing process.

Salesforce testing life cycle is critical to ensuring that applications function as intended and deliver user value. By following best practices and incorporating testing early and often throughout the software development life cycle, businesses can reduce the risk of errors, improve user experience, and drive growth and success. As the importance of Salesforce continues to grow, businesses must prioritize testing and ensure that their applications meet quality standards and deliver value to users. Enrolling in a reputable Training Institute in Chennai to enhance your Salesforce testing skills and stay ahead in the competitive landscape.